Course Details
• Streamer Privacy Best Practices: An introduction to key privacy concepts for streamers, including the importance of maintaining privacy, potential threats, and best practices for protecting personal information.
• Privacy Settings on Streaming Platforms: A deep dive into the privacy settings available on popular streaming platforms, with step-by-step instructions for configuring these settings to maximize privacy and security.
• Managing Online Presence: Techniques for managing online presence and reputation, including how to control personal information and images, use privacy-enhancing tools, and handle online harassment and doxxing.
• Securing Personal Devices: Best practices for securing personal devices used for streaming, including setting strong passwords, using two-factor authentication, and implementing antivirus software.
• Secure Communication Channels: An overview of secure communication channels for streamers, including end-to-end encrypted messaging apps, virtual private networks (VPNs), and secure email services.
• Privacy in Virtual Events: Tips for maintaining privacy during virtual events, including how to use virtual backgrounds, manage screen sharing, and avoid unwanted attention from viewers.
• Legal Considerations for Streamers: An overview of legal considerations for streamers, including copyright law, privacy laws, and reporting requirements for online harassment and cyberbullying.
• Crisis Management for Streamers: Strategies for managing crises related to privacy violations, including how to respond to doxxing, swatting, and other forms of online harassment.
